When applying for a position at BNP Paribas, your cover letter is an opportunity for you to tell your story, without being stuck in the formatting constraints of the resume. The best format for writing a cover letter is as follows:

  • Address the employer with a formal salutation. For example, “Dear/Hello (name of the recipient).” If you do not know the recipient’s name, you can refer to them as the hiring manager.
  • The next step is to state the position you are applying for and how you found the opening. 
  • Make a brief statement about why you’re interested in the position. Write a paragraph about why you are the perfect candidate for the job.
  • State your skills and work experience. Ensure your skills and experiences are similar to the job position. When highlighting skills, provide the accomplishment you have achieved. 
  • Conclude your letter with a forward-looking statement. For example, “I look forward to discussing the position further.”

Sample 1:

“POSITION: Graduate Program

Dear Hiring Manager,

I am writing to express my interest in the position “2017 APAC Graduate Program – Global Markets”, as advertised on the career website of my university. Along with my degree in Risk Management Science and summer internship experience in banking industry, I am eager to leverage my practical skills and academic knowledge to contribute to your bottom line.

BNP Paribas clearly stands out in the financial services industry. The staggering growth pace and strong capital position have proven that your company’s strategy is a success. For instance, BNP Paribas’s core capital was 10% above Basel III framework in 2015, demonstrating the firm’s flexibility under the new regime of regulatory capital. In an amazing show of its perseverance and sustainability, BNP Paribas escaped from the 2007 credit crisis unscathed, its profits even increased €3 billion for the year of 2008, and €5.8 billion for 2009.

I always have a genuine interest in investment banking, demonstrated by my minor in Finance, which has equipped me with the relevant knowledge and skills to fit in this position. I am familiar with the financial and derivative markets, with coursework related to valuation of Fixed Income, Equity and Derivative, such as bond pricing, Dividend Discount Model, Black Scholes Model and Ito’s Calculus. The quantitative nature of my degree has well-prepared me to join and contribute to your firm.Given my background and skillset, I believe I am a particularly good fit for the position. 

A copy of my resume is enclosed for your reference. I would welcome an opportunity to discuss my qualifications with you and learn more about BNP Paribas at your earliest convenience. Thank you very much for your time and consideration.

Yours faithfully,”

Frequently Asked Questions:

What are the common mistakes to avoid when writing a cover letter?

Here are a few common mistakes to avoid:

  • Don’t focus on yourself too much.
  • Don’t write salary expectations.
  • Avoid long paragraphs.
